Pre-fix, submit_for_qa opened a PR (side effect) and returned OK with next='call i_am_done' — agents read the verb name, assumed they were done with QA handoff, never called i_am_done, and PRs ended up orphaned (PR #12 in the 2026-05-08 trace). Two changes: 1. Rename submit_for_qa -> open_pr so the verb name matches the semantic. The PR opens here; the actual QA handoff happens at i_am_done. Renamed across: - choreographer/_impl.py (method) - mcp/flow_server.py (tool registration + _TOOLS dict) - api/routes/v2/flow_dev.py (route + handler) - api/schemas/v2/flow.py (OpenPrRequest) - services/gateway/verb_gates.py (_STATE_VERBS) - services/gateway/role_config.py (developer flow manifest) - services/gateway/content_actions.py (commit-success next= hint) - agent_sdk/server.py (post-tool guidance map) - runtime/orchestrator.py (developer prompt) - agents/prompts/{base,roles/developer,_generated/*}.md - tests/unit/gateway/test_submit_for_qa.py -> test_open_pr.py - tests/unit/api/routes/v2/test_flow_dev.py - tests/unit/gateway/test_verb_gates.py - tests/unit/api/test_correlation_id.py - tests/unit/mcp_servers/test_flow_server.py - tests/integration/test_full_lifecycle_real_db.py 2. New regression test (test_open_pr_does_not_create_pr_if_no_commits) pins the atomic invariant: preconditions (assignee, commits, no-prior-PR) must be checked BEFORE git.create_pr/push_branch run. Any future re-ordering breaks the test. Tests: 3128 passing (3127 + 1 new), 100% coverage, ruff clean. Note: TaskService.submit_for_qa() (the v1-layer service method) is INTENTIONALLY not renamed — it's a different layer used by the v1 routes. The rename here is only the gateway verb surface.
